Hackers cracked two-factor Authentication

The initially thought very secure two-factor authentication (2FA) security measure commonly employed by banks on Internet Banking sites has cracked. Hackers have shown how 2FA can be defeated.

It now looks like enterprises have to come out with an even stronger three-pronged approach to beef up security net. The billion dollar question is "Will there ever be a security foolproof method?".
